WebOct 14, 2024 · What Is Triangulation? In psychology, triangulation is a term used to describe when a person uses threats of exclusion or manipulation. Its goal is to divide and conquer. A form of manipulation, triangulation involves the use of indirect communication, often behind someone's back. WebAlmost as famous as the Pull a Rabbit out of My Hat trick, this death-defying Stage Magician trick involves a pretty woman (usually the magician's Lovely Assistant) being placed into a coffin-sized lidded wooden box, with a neck-hole in the top and ankle-holes in the bottom. Then, producing a large floppy hand-saw, the magician proceeds to saw ...
